Shehr e Khaas Martial Arts Academy shines with 12 medals in Pencak Silat competition

Shehr e Khaas Martial Arts Academy shines with 12 medals in Pencak Silat competition
Share on Facebook

Rehan Qayoom Mir

Srinagar, Feb 26: In a remarkable display of skill and determination, Shehr-e-Khaas Martial Arts Academy has clinched 12 medals in the prestigious Pencak Silat competition held across India.

As per the details available with the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), the team’s impressive medal tally includes seven gold, three bronze, and two silver medals, showcasing their exceptional talent and dedication to the sport.

“Among the gold medalists are Rutba Showkot, who also secured one silver and Sira Hilal, Amina with 2 golds each and Shakir, Ibrahim, and Burhan with one gold each.”

“The academy’s success extends to its younger members, with two promising young girls demonstrating their prowess in the competition,” said an academy official adding that they have started the academy some six to seven months ago.

He said they have two academies with a total enrollment of 60 (30 each).

“This outstanding achievement not only highlights the academy’s commitment to excellence but also serves as a source of inspiration for aspiring athletes across the region,” said Rutba who has two medals—(KNO)
